Capital Campaign 2024
St. Mark has grown from 250 families in 1997 to over 5,000 in 2024. with this growth has come an increase of parishioner participation in our 80+ ministries and groups. Over 600 children are involved in our Faith Formation program, and about 60 people involved in our OCIA/RCIA programs. St. Mark School, located on our property, opened in 2003, and has over 700 children in grades K-8. Christ the King High School, located about 15 minutes away, opened in 2011, and has 400+ students.
Our Perpetual Adoration Chapel has seats for 20 people, but is often overcrowded.
The Rectory for our priests is located 15 minutes away, and houses 4 full time priests and 2 seminarians, with other visiting on a regular basis.
We propose with this Capital Campaign to build the following:
- A new Parish Life Center, named for Monsignor Richard Bellow
- A larger Adoration Chapel, with seating for 75
- A new Rectory located at the Ranson Road property, across the street from the Church, with housing for 8 priests and seminarians
Our total projected cost for these additions is $13.7 million. With the sale of the current rectory and loans, our Campaign Goal is $9.7 million.
